00:00President Trump threatened to impose 200% tariffs on foreign-made pharmaceuticals,
00:05giving companies 12 to 18 months to shift production to the U.S.
00:09Despite the announcement, markets and investors largely dismissed the threat as political posturing,
00:15citing major logistical and regulatory challenges to relocating drug manufacturing.
00:20Countries like Australia and India, key pharmaceutical exporters to the U.S.,
00:25warn the move could lead to higher drug prices, supply chain disruptions, and global health risks.
